Taxpayers to Complete NADRA Biometric Verification At Home

The National Database and Registration Authority (NADRA) is set to launch online biometric verification through its PakID app for individual taxpayers, sole proprietors and overseas Pakistanis in the first week of September 2026.

The new facility will allow eligible taxpayers to complete their required biometric verification remotely without visiting a physical verification centre.

NADRA said the functionality has already been developed and will make the annual biometric verification process easier, particularly for taxpayers living abroad.

The authority is also working with the Federal Board of Revenue (FBR) to have PakID biometric verification formally recognized as an alternative to the existing e-Sahulat-based verification process.

Once approved by the FBR, taxpayers will have an additional digital option for completing their biometric requirement.

The development follows concerns raised by the Faisalabad Chamber of Small Traders & Small Industry over difficulties faced by individual taxpayers and sole proprietors in completing annual biometric verification, particularly overseas Pakistanis.

NADRA said the new facility would enable eligible users to complete biometric verification from anywhere in the world.

The authority said the initiative is aimed at simplifying taxpayer compliance and supporting the government’s digitalization and ease-of-doing-business agenda.

However, NADRA has described the first-week-of-September launch as only tentative. The formal approval by FBR to recognize PakID as an alternative verification channel is still being pursued.
